Five years ago Suzanne and Margie both faced their own career transitions. We’ll learn how they met and decided to co-found and co-facilitate Career Transitions of Greater Boston, a free weekly workshop for professionals in career transition.
Their unique approach has helped springboard hundreds of professionals (including themselves) into new careers.
They offer complimentary coaching services to professionals who are interested in learning more about self-employment and business ownership opportunities.
